Firefighters are investigating a blaze that destroyed an abandoned building at Adamstown in the early hours of Tuesday morning.

Fire and Rescue NSW crews were called to the premises on Park Avenue, on the property next to Adamstown Car Doctors, about 4.30am.
No-one was inside at the time the fire broke out.
Firefighters from six stations - 11 units - responded to the blaze.
It took them about 90 minutes to get the fire under control.
A Fire and Rescue NSW spokesperson said an investigation into the cause of the fire is underway.
The spokesperson said the abandoned building was totally destroyed in the blaze.
